 | Enterprise Ai's Evolving Landscape Enterprise artificial intelligence is advancing beyond simple conversational tools, with AI systems now executing complex automated workflows. OpenRouter reports that enterprise AI agents logged 7.3 trillion agentic tokens, indicating a shift towards sophisticated AI applications. The top 10% of enterprise AI users are generating significantly more output than typical enterprises, highlighting a growing gap in AI adoption and utilization. |
 | Ai in the Global Economy: Capex Slowdown Impacts A slowdown in global AI capital expenditure could shift financial pressures from Asia to the US, according to a Nuvama report. The AI investment boom has supported the US current account deficit, but a potential decline could weaken the US dollar and elevate Treasury yields. This change may stress traditional sectors and affect economic growth in regions like South Korea, Taiwan, and China, which have benefited from AI investments. Additionally, Nuvama Research warns that India's cyclical recovery could be threatened by reduced AI capex, affecting corporate revenue and economic momentum. |
 | Autonomous Ai: Potential and Challenges The rise of autonomous AI employees is transforming operational efficiency by automating routine tasks. While this enhances productivity, it also requires robust governance to manage data security and ethical risks. In parallel, successful enterprises are recognizing the limitations of full autonomy in AI projects. Gartner forecasts that many agentic AI projects may fail by 2028 due to high costs and unclear value, prompting a shift towards narrow-scope agents and stronger compliance measures. |
 | Ai Agents and the Rise of Crypto Payments AI agents are increasingly handling online transactions, primarily using USDC stablecoins for purchasing data and computational resources. Coinbase's x402 protocol has enabled over 165 million transactions, highlighting the growing ecosystem of agentic payments. This trend offers advantages like reduced processing fees and seamless cross-border transactions, although it remains in its early stages of development. |
 | Global Ai Governance and Innovation The 2026 World AI Conference in Shanghai showcased significant AI advancements, with over 3,000 innovations and 300 new products. The event emphasized the transformative impact of AI across industries and underscored the need for global collaboration in AI governance. Chinese President Xi Jinping advocated for openness and inclusivity to address ethical challenges and ensure AI benefits are widely distributed. |
